BOSTON (AP) — A package exploded on the campus of Northeastern University in Boston on Tuesday, and the college said a staff member suffered minor injuries.

Authorities said another suspicious package was found at a major art museum and the FBI was assisting in the investigation.
The package that exploded was one of two that were reported to police in the evening. Boston bomb squad neutralized a second package near the city’s Museum of Fine Arts, which sits on the edge of the northeast campus.
NBC Boston reported that the package, which exploded, exploded as it was being opened in the university’s Holmes Hall, which houses the university’s creative writing program and its women’s, gender, and sexuality studies program. He said the FBI is supporting the investigation.

Authorities declined to comment, but Northeastern spokeswoman Shannon Nargi said in a statement that an unidentified university employee sustained minor hand injuries in the blast. Felipe Colon, a Boston police superintendent, later described the victim as a 45-year-old man.
Police arrived on campus just before 7:30 pm, and the university asked students who had gathered in the lobby for an evening journalism class to evacuate the building.
Northeastern is a private university in downtown Boston with approximately 16,000 undergraduate students. WCVB-TV said one of its reporters, Mike Beaudet, was giving a class there at the time. Beaudet told the station his class was moved outside but that neither he nor his students heard an explosion.

Northeastern Police Chief Michael Davis told reporters the campus was safe. Boston Police did not say whether any other suspicious packages were found.
“We are monitoring the situation in Northeastern and stand ready to work with the university and our law enforcement partners on any allegations that may develop,” Suffolk County District Attorney Kevin Hayden said, promising “a full investigation to determine exactly what happened. here.”
Harvard University and the Massachusetts Institute of Technology, both on the other side of the Charles River that separates Boston from Cambridge, said they were increasing patrols on their campuses as a precaution and urging students and faculty to report anything suspicious.

The 3MT is an academic competition that challenges PhD students to describe their research within three minutes, using a static slide.
Winners will receive great prizes from the library, including a guest appearance on the What’s New podcast for the top 3 finishers, 3D printing studio credit ($100 for 1st place and $50 for 2nd), as well as gift cards for local businesses.
If you want to present your doctoral thesis, you must send an abstract of your thesis (250-300 words).

STR is a rapidly growing privately held company focused on research and development for the defense and intelligence communities, headquartered in Woburn, MA. STR has approximately 200 employees in locations in Woburn, MA, Dayton, OH and Arlington, VA. STR is a nationally recognized leader in research areas including data analytics, sensor and signal processing, electronic warfare, cyber, video and image understanding, command and control, and precision navigation. Several programs have transferred advanced technology to military and intelligence users. While their primary focus is on serving US government customers, they also pursue commercial applications. Dr. Laura Vertatschitschis Senior Researcher at Systems & Technology Research (STR). She is a radar systems expert with experience and publications in the fields of numerical modeling of ionospheric scattering phenomena, broadband digital signal processing, and digital receiver instrumentation for radar and astrophysics applications. During his PhD. she (University of Washington, Department of Electrical Engineering) has developed a passive radar system that uses over-the-air digital television broadcasting for aircraft detection. During her postdoctoral fellowship at the Harvard-Smithsonian Center for Astrophysics, she developed and implemented broadband digital reception systems for the Event Horizon Telescope, a global sub-mm radio deployment.
